摘要
Vibration suction is a kind of suction method which is newly introduced by researchers. It is a key technique of wall-climbing robots and will determine the movement gait and mechanical structures of robots. According to the theory of vibration suction, a new type of vibration suction module is designed. Experiments are carried out to test the suction performance of the module, and the result shows that the module has enough reliability. A mini multi-joint wall climbing robot is designed based on Vibration Suction. Experiments proved that this robot can finish three kinds of movements: in straight line, turning and waling form one face to another successfully.
